§ 47-40-122 — Advisory Committee for Motorcycle Safety and Education.

Oklahoma·Title 47 Motor Vehicles
A.There is hereby created the Advisory Committee for Motorcycle Safety and Education which shall be comprised of the Administrator of the Motorcycle Safety and Education Program in the Department of Public Safety, who shall serve as chair of the Committee and shall be a nonvoting member, and seven (7) voting members, six of whom shall be appointed by the Commissioner of Public Safety and one of whom shall be appointed by the Insurance Commissioner. Legislative History

Added by Laws 1999, c. 342, § 2, eff. Nov. 1, 1999. Amended by Laws 2002, c. 472, § 2, eff. July 1, 2002; Laws 2010, c. 70, § 1, emerg. eff. April 9, 2010.
